Measurement of thermoelectric modules
Martynek, Filip ; Baláš, Marek (referee) ; Brázdil, Marian (advisor)
This thesis describes principles of thermoelectric change, crucial parameters of thermoelectric modules and issues of its measurements. Theoretical part of this research is aimed on describing thermoelectrical phenomena, composition of thermoelectric pair and modules, naming searched parameters and issues that occurred during its measurements. Further in detail describes chosen testing approaches. In the end these methods are concluded and compared. Practical part contains description of testing device and experimental measurement of thermoelectric module.
Application of Thermoelectric Module for Temperature Control
Gofroň, Vojtěch ; Andrš, Ondřej (referee) ; Houška, Pavel (advisor)
This bachelor thesis describes the possibilities of use thermoelectric modules for temperature control in a temperature chamber. In the theoretical part are shown physical principles of thermoelectric cooling, heating and power generation. The main part regarding thermoelectric modules describes its design, use and important parameters for temperature control. The next chapter is focused on measuring of quantities important for temperature control using thermoelectric modules. The last part describes few proposals of a temperature chamber design.

Temperature measurement
Brzobohatý, Lukáš ; Kandus, Bohumil (referee) ; Podaný, Kamil (advisor)
ABSTRACT Brzobohatý Lukáš: Temperature measurement The work presents a comprehensive overview of measurements of one of the basic state function determining the state of matter - the temperature. It deals with development of temperature scales, units and measuring devices. Temperature measurement is divided into two basic ways - contact and non-contact method. Contact measuring devices emphasis on thermocouples because of their indispensability in all industries. Non-contact temperature measurement is most developing method. This corresponds to the devices development, which is determined by the rapid computer technology development.

Non-contact Temperature Measurement
Lata, Miroslav ; Janečka, Jan (referee) ; Vdoleček, František (advisor)
The object of this bachelor thesis was to create a study of development non-contact temperature measurement and show methods of measurement in infra-red radiation area. The beginning of this work is focused on major notions and definitions necessary to introduce non-contact temperature measurement topic. Other interest of this work was to mention possible error rate of measurement, it’s reasons then name some ways of calibration of a measuring equipment with it’s reasons too. Last part of this thesis was focused on a practical using of these measuring devices.
Microsolder controlled by microprocessor
Stavělík, J.
The aim of this thesis is to design microsolder control, which can hold constant temperature of solder tip and description of hardware and firmware implementation. This solution allows the same function like classical microsolders but you can connect modern solder tip with high heat capacity. Other requirements are: switching frequency should be above the audible frequency, rotary encoder for temperature adjust, LCD display.
